The other meaning of “Chi” in Igbo
Like many Igbo words, ‘Chi’ has more than one meaning. It’s well known that ‘Chi’ means ‘life source, soul, essence, existence etc’ often mistranslated as ‘God’, however, it can also mean day/daylight. In this video, we take you through a few words/phrases that incorporate ‘Chi’ as daylight.

Ihe Nketa Nwanyi: Female Inheritance in Igboland
Ihe nketa: Female inheritance in Igboland. It’s widely known that traditionally inheritance is passed through the male lineage. There are however exceptions in Ohafia (Abia) and Afikpo (Ebonyi).
